Context

The role is responsible for exploring, developing and executing parts of specific product groups and/or partnerships together with the Senor Consultant - Product Management to achieve the annual margin & NPS targets and our longer term growth targets. The ability to learn and develop quickly and being adaptable is key for this role. The role works closely with both external partners and internal teams. This role works specifically on traditional telco payment services (from premium services to carrier billing) and finds innovative ways to increase customer satisfaction and profitability.
